Chongqing Tsingshan Begins Volume Production of High-Power Coaxial E-Drive, Secures New SERES Projec

Edited by Aya From Gasgoo

Gasgoo Munich- Chongqing Tsingshan Industrial Co., Ltd. announced the start of mass production for its next-generation high-power coaxial e-drive. The system is already installed in vehicles from brands like AVATR and VOYAH, which have been delivered to customers, and it has secured a new project designation from Seres. Public information indicates that monthly demand for the product has already surpassed 20,000 units. For Chongqing Tsingshan, which is currently transitioning its business toward new energy vehicles, the entry of the coaxial e-drive into the volume production phase signals that its e-drive operations are moving from technical validation to large-scale delivery.

In terms of specifications, the e-drive utilizes a coaxial architecture, achieving a power density of 3.8 kW/kg and an operating efficiency of over 94%. The core philosophy is not to blindly pursue higher power, but to seek a balance between vehicle space, weight, and efficiency by shortening the transmission path and increasing integration.

Specifically, Chongqing Tsingshan employs a planetary gear topology to deeply integrate the motor, reducer, and controller. Compared to traditional parallel-axis e-drives, this approach further compresses Z-direction space. Additionally, energy loss is reduced through a combination of hardware and software measures, including low-viscosity oils, high-precision mirror grinding, variable drive resistance, and pulse torque control.

The aforementioned product originates from Chongqing Tsingshan's GI-Drive 2.0 intelligent e-drive platform. Officially released in 2025, the platform covers application scenarios for both hybrid and pure electric vehicles, extending to centralized, coaxial, and distributed drive systems. Public records show that the GI-Drive 2.0 platform comprises 293 domestic and international invention patents and 119 key core technologies, reflecting Chongqing Tsingshan's accelerated transformation from a traditional transmission supplier to an e-drive system provider.

It is worth noting that competition in the current e-drive market has shifted from a question of availability to a comprehensive contest of efficiency, power density, cost, and integration capabilities. For instance, AVATR's latest distributed e-drive has a published power density of 4.52 kW/kg and an operating efficiency of 92.8%. This implies that metrics of 3.8 kW/kg and 94% are not sufficient on their own to form an absolute barrier. The real test of Chongqing Tsingshan's e-drive competitiveness will be its ability to continuously secure designations from mainstream automakers and maintain cost and quality stability as production volumes expand.
